Released September 30th, 1952, 'Something for the Birds' stars Larry Keating The movie has a runtime of about 1 hr 21 min, and received a score of (out of 100) on TMDb, which collated reviews from knowledgeable s.

Interested in knowing what the movie's about? Here's the plot: "A conservationist fights to save the habitat of the California condor and to do it she works her way into the affections of a representative of the oil company that wants the land for their own purposes." .
